| Aspect | Medical Imaging Receptionist | Medical Office Receptionist |
|---|
| Credentials | Typically high school diploma; certification not always required | Typically high school diploma; certification not always required |
| Work Environment | Radiology clinics, imaging centers, hospitals | Doctor's offices, clinics, healthcare facilities |
| Job Duties | Scheduling imaging appointments, patient check-in, insurance verification for imaging services | Scheduling general appointments, patient check-in, billing, administrative tasks |
Both roles involve front-desk duties in healthcare settings, but Medical Imaging Receptionists specialize in radiology and imaging services, requiring familiarity with imaging procedures. Medical Office Receptionists handle broader administrative tasks across various medical departments.
